Ambassador Role & Responsibilities



Role
As an Exploritas representative, you will be responsible for educating and communicating a positive, current, and accurate image of Exploritas to older adults in your community.

Basic Responsibilities
• Share your Exploritas enthusiasm and lifelong learning spirit with others in your area.
• Develop, schedule, and/or accept (from headquarters) 8 speaking engagements in your community to educate older adults about Exploritas each year.
• Keep up to date and knowledgeable on Exploritas programming, policies, history, catalog, website and new developments.
• Serve as a liaison between the national office and your community by offering feedback from local Exploritasers as well as reporting to headquarters on your Ambassador activities.
• Upon availability, participate in local conferences, tradeshows, or expositions as an Exploritas representative.

Requirements and Skills
• Enthusiasm for Exploritas
• Outgoing, people person
• Experience with three or more Exploritas programs
• Presentation, communication and organizational skills
• Willingness to forge relationships with local organizations, groups, associations, retirement communities, and media
• Ability to travel (you will determine the distance of travel you would prefer)
• Internet access a plus
